/* Hacky way to get a direct, but temporary MP4 link for a YouTube video
Usage: Open YouTube in browser and run code in the dev. console
References:
https://tyrrrz.me/Blog/Reverse-engineering-YouTube
https://gist.github.com/el3zahaby/9e60f1ae3168c38cc0f0054c15cd6a83
http://rg3.github.io/youtube-dl/ https://github.com/rg3/youtube-dl/
const videoInfoRegex = /(?:quality=(\w*?),)(?:type=video\/mp4.*?)&url=(.*?),/g; // find all mp4 links
*/
// FIXME: Doesn't work on copyrighted music, verified accounts, etc. See references for info.
async function extractYoutubeMp4Link(vidId) {
const regex = /type=video\/mp4.*?&url=(.*?),/; // find first mp4 link
const findStr = 'url_encoded_fmt_stream_map=';
const findStrLen = findStr.length;
const vidInfo = await getVideoInfo(vidId);
const decodedInfo = decodeURIComponent(decodeURIComponent(vidInfo));
const streamMap = decodedInfo.substr(decodedInfo.indexOf(findStr) + findStrLen);
return regex.exec(streamMap)[1];
}
function getVideoInfo(vidId) {
const url = `https://www.youtube.com/get_video_info?video_id=${vidId}`;
return fetch(url, {
mode: "no-cors",
})
.then(res => res.text())
.then(body => body);
}
function getYoutubeMp4Link(vidId) {
extractYoutubeMp4Link(vidId)
.then(url => console.log(url))
.catch(err => console.error(err));
}
// example
var ytVideoId = '5FKMTt2Yz60'
getYoutubeMp4Link(ytVideoId);
